The Best Foldable Ramp For Wheelchairs

A wheelchair ramp is a vital tool for anyone in a wheelchair, allowing them to maintain independence and enjoy life beyond barriers. Many people choose a portable folding ramp for this purpose, as they can be quickly deployed when needed.

The majority are tri-folded or bi-folded with hinges between each panel. They are also smaller so they can be tucked away in cars of all sizes. Some of them can be folded into two smaller pieces.

There are several different types of portable ramps available such as single-fold ramps that fold in half and are transported like suitcases, with handles. They are typically made from lightweight, durable materials such as aluminum. There are also tri-fold ramps that separate in sections before folding, reducing the number of pieces and making them easier to move.

The threshold ramp is a different kind of ramp used to pass through doors that are too high for wheelchairs or scooters. These ramps are typically made of a material that is able to support the weight of a wheelchair, and they offer traction for safe use. They can also be adjusted in height to meet the threshold of a door.

Easy to Assemble

Foldable ramps for wheelchairs are one of the most versatile accessibility products on the market. They are easy to assemble and are available in various sizes. They are perfect for situations where a permanent stairway or ramp is not feasible, such as curbs and steps. They can also be used for access to vehicles. When using this type ramp it is crucial that at the very least one person who can walk is able to assist the person who is in the wheelchair. This will ensure that the ramp does not slip, which can cause serious injuries.

Once you've received your portable ramp, make sure you check it for any damage before using it. Then, unfold it and place it on the ground in a general area of where you want it. If you bought a single-fold ramp, fold it like a huge book, then flip it so that the black non skid surface is visible. Some ramps have straps to hold them together. Take these straps off to open the ramp, allowing it to expand to its entire length.

Easy to Store

The most efficient ramp that folds for wheelchairs is lightweight, compact, and easy to carry. It must have a high-traction surface to reduce the possibility of falling or slipping. The ramp should be constructed with handles that allow for easier movement and transport the ramp. A ramp that has an open hinge in the center can be divided into two pieces, making it easier to transport. These models are lighter and cheaper than tri-fold ramps however they might not provide as much stability.

Portable ramps are useful for people who are in wheelchairs or use scooters to get into their homes. They can also be helpful when visiting friends or family members with stairs that can be difficult to climb. Some ramps can fit inside the trunk. It is crucial to determine whether the ramp can take the load and ensure that it is not loaded beyond its limits. The ramp should also be inspected regularly for signs of wear and damage. Loose bolts and screws should be tightened, and hinges and the folding joints must be lubricated regularly.

A good portable wheelchair ramp is one that can hold up to 800 lbs. It should also be able to accommodate different threshold heights. The load incline is suggested to be at least 12 inches per inch of rise. However, this can differ based on the user's needs.
